Specifications
- Pk:96 Tests
- Assay duration:Multiple steps
- Assay Type:Sandwich
- Format:Pre-coated
- Primary antibody reactivity:Rat
- Target protein:68 kDa Neurofilament/NF-L
- Description:Rat 68kDa Neurofilament/NF-L ELISA kit
- Sample type:Serum, plasma, tissue homogenates and other biological fluids
- Cross reactivity:Rat 68kDa Neurofilament/NF-L ELISA Kit exhibits high specificity and excellent specificity for the detection of rat 68kDa Neurofilament/NF-L. No significant cross-reactivity or interference between 68kDa Neurofilament/NF-L and analogues was observed.
- Detection method:Colorimetric
- Time to Results:4 h 30 min
- Assay Principle:Quantitative
- Shelf life:Store for 6 months at 4 °C
- Detection range:15,625 - 1000 pg/ml
- Storage temperature:4 °C
- Sample volume:100 μl
- Sensitivity:9,375 pg/ml
- Regulatory status:RUO

Rat 68kDa Neurofilament / NF-L ELISA Kit (A79558) employs the sandwich enzyme immunoassay technique for the quantitative measurement of rat 68kDa Neurofilament / NF-L in serum, plasma, tissue homogenates, and other biological fluids. An antibody specific for 68kDa Neurofilament / NF-L has been pre-coated onto a 96-well microtiter plate. The standards and test samples are added into the wells and the 68kDa Neurofilament / NF-L present in each sample is bound to the wells by the immobilized antibody. Following incubation, the wells are washed and then incubated with Biotinylated Anti-68kDa Neurofilament / NF-L Antibody, which binds the captured 68kDa Neurofilament / NF-L present in each well. Following incubation, unbound biotinylated detection antibody is removed by washing, and an HRP-Streptavidin conjugate is added to the wells and the microtiter plate is incubated. Following incubation and washing, TMB substrate solution is then used to visualize the HRP enzymatic reaction by catalysis to produce a blue-coloured product that changes to yellow after addition of acidic stop solution. The density of yellow is proportional to the amount of 68kDa Neurofilament / NF-L captured in each well. The concentration of 68kDa Neurofilament / NF-L can then be calculated by reading the O.D. absorbance at 450nm in a microplate reader and referring to the standard curve.
